通过这种方式,我可以在MySQL中创建一个带有时间戳字段的表: id INT NOT NULL AUTO_INCREMENT PRIMARY KEY, name varchar(255)它将在每次插入新行时自动插入时间戳值。---+------++----+---------------------+------+
假设我有一个这样的表: gid BIGINT PRIMARY KEY, endtime BIGINT此表存储一系列游戏的开始和结束时间(格式为“从纪元开始的秒数”)。FROM foo f WHERE @t BETWEEN f.starttime AND f.endtime;
复杂的是,我需要每五分钟做一次(每场比赛只持续几分钟,我们每小时有几千人),而且可能需要六个月的时间我目前将所有@t存储在一个单独的表</